E. Lockhart Quote

A tomato may be a fruit, but it is a singular fruit. A savory fruit. A fruit that has ambitions far beyond the ambitions of other fruits.


The Disreputable History of Frankie Landau-Banks (ed. Hot Key Books, 2014) - ISBN: 9781471404412
